Abstract

For control systems described by ordinary differential equations and given subsets A of the state space, the points on the boundary of A through which entrance and exit is possible are studied. We assume that solutions that leave A and remain close to it cannot return. Continuity properties of the entrance and exit boundaries when the control range is changed are described.
